    Alabama ( / ˌæləˈbæmə / AL-ə-BAM-ə) [9] is a state in the Southeastern region of the United States. It borders Tennessee to the north, Georgia to the east, Florida and the Gulf of Mexico to the south, and Mississippi to the west. Alabama is the 30th largest by area [10] and the 24th-most populous of the 50 U.S. states. [11]

  4. Jun 27, 2023 · Alabama's population according to 2020 Census estimates was 5,024,279. Approximately 67.5 percent identified themselves white, 26.6 as African American, 4.4 percent as Hispanic, 2.4 percent as two or more races, 1.4 percent as Asian, and 0.5 percent as Native American.

  5. Alabama, State, south-central U.S. Area: 52,420 sq mi (135,767 sq km). Population: (2020) 5,024,279; (2023 est.) 5,108,468. Capital: Montgomery. It is bordered by Tennessee, Georgia, Florida, and Mississippi; the Gulf of Mexico lies to the southwest.

  7. Alabama is the thirty-first largest state in the United States with 52,419 square miles (135,760 km 2) of total area. 3.18% of the area is water, making Alabama twenty-third in the amount of surface water, also giving it the second-largest inland waterway system in the United States.
